Television screens at 7 Eleven and train stations in Taiwan hacked to display insults to Nancy Pelosi
2022-08-04
Taiwan has denounced this Thursday the hacking of TV screens at several chain stores and government facilities this Wednesday in coincidence with the presence on the island of the presidentRead More →